I just completed a test grow with it.
-Large plants ranging from light to heavy feeders. Fed dtw on auto drip twice per day at 20% runoff in 15 gallon containers. EC of runoff was measured every two days. The solution was mixed to last 7-12 days. The Light strength chart was followed to a "T."

Balance- No deficiencies, but if you follow the chart, you may notice an overdose of N for the first few weeks of flower. IMO this attributed to the chart recommending too much Start-R which also resulted in looser than normal buds.

Bling- very nice!

Smell- Not organic but better than AN, H & G, Cyco, General Organics or PBP. Nothing like Canna with Boost Accelerator (hard to beat for a synth/ natural combo fert.

Reservoir Stability- I wouldn't recommend mixing this up to last for more than a few days. pH rose at least 0.3 per day. A recirculatory pump is also necessary to avoid the salts or organics falling out of suspension, even with heavy air infusion. The EC at the bottom of an uncirculated tank was consistently 0.2-0.5 lower.

The biggest lie about the nutrient- Mad salt buildup on reservoir walls and pumps. Worse than any nutrient I have ever used besides miracle grow (its okay to laugh, we have all likely been there for some plant in our lives.) I thought Cyco was bad on Salt buildup....

Would I use it again? Yes, but under modified conditions. DON'T BELIEVE EVERYTHING THAT WE READ.

A reservoir would last 7-10 days. I observed salt rings from every feed. Kinda cool actually. I was able to measure my 150 gallon in each feeds increments due to it.

Its a nice line, but for my style it doesn't work well. IMO its more designed for hand watering soil with an average plant in mind. If you need to specifically tailor a certain variety, another company's supplements might need to be used. Ill be running it one more time with a fresh set of bottles and Cyco Silica to stabilize the pH. Mills sure isn't concentrated compared to a few other lines out there. I exhausted 20 liters of each base and several 5 liters of the supplements for my tester 4K.

My well water is clean at 40 ppm. In the past I have had issues at another location regarding rising pH. The well had low ppm water but it had a high iron content. This phenomenon does not occur at this site. I have never seen such a high pH swing on any other line besides Soul Synthetics.
